Why was Echo only able to repeat Narcissus's words?
Black_prince [1.1K]

Answer:

The moment she saw Narcissus traipsing through the forest, she fell in love with him and his breathtaking beauty. But because of Hera's curse, she was unable to tell him, so she followed the boy and waited for him to speak. ... Ever opportunistic, Echo repeated his words and leapt towards Narcissus.

What is implied textual evidence?
Ierofanga [76]

Answer:

Implied (or implicit) textual evidence is suggested but not directly stated. When a reader comes across implied textual evidence, they have to: put together details in the text to draw a conclusion and make educated guesses
